A single-car driver in Danville, California pays $2,127 for their auto insurance each year. This works out to $177 per month. The Bay Area suburb is half an hour east of San Francisco. It has been rated one of the safest cities in California for four years. The city's car insurance rates are also below the state average but slightly higher than the national average. In Danville, finding a cheap car insurance policy is often easier than finding moderately priced real estate.

AARP has partnered with The Hartford to offer discounts on car insurance for members. AARP members can save up to 20% on their policies through this partnership. Furthermore, AARP members can bundle their auto insurance and homeowners insurance to save even more money. In addition, the Hartford offers free weekender duffel bags to its members. Acceptance car insurance

If you're looking for auto insurance in Danville California, you may want to consider accepting an Acceptance car insurance quote. This company specializes in auto insurance for high-risk drivers and often offers rates that are higher than average. If you're a high-risk driver with bad credit, a history of accidents, or poor driving record, you might be a good fit for this company.

Acceptance offers a number of convenient methods of contact, such as a telephone number and a live chat feature. However, they do not offer 24-hour customer service. Their claims department is only open Monday through Friday from 6 a.m. to 8 p.m., and Saturdays are closed. Any claims made on weekends will not be processed until the office reopens. The company also has an app available for both Android and iPhone users.
